Our Journey Since 1861
The story of John Smeal Exports is deeply intertwined with the rich history of Assam and the visionary leadership of the Mukherjee family. Founded in 1861 by Mr. Kshetra Mohan Mukherjee, John Smeal was one of the first registered companies in Assam. What began as a modest FMCG business quickly expanded into a ship repairing factory, serving the East India Company. This early connection with the East India Company laid the foundation for our enduring legacy in trade and industry.
As hunting became a favored pastime among the elite, the business diversified into the distribution of air guns, catering to this growing demand. As the years passed, the next generation of the Mukherjee family began to take their place in the business, bringing with them fresh perspectives and a drive for expansion.
Mr. Sadhan Kumar Mukherjee, the torchbearer of the second generation, took the reins of the business and set his sights on new horizons. Under his leadership, the company ventured into the liquor distribution industry, further solidifying its presence in the market. His strategic vision and dedication propelled the business to new heights, paving the way for future growth.
The baton was then passed to the third generation, with Mr. Buddhadeb Mukherjee at the helm. His leadership saw the business grow tenfold, as he expanded into hardware, electronics, and precious metals such as gold and silver. His entrepreneurial spirit and keen business acumen ensured that the company continued to thrive and diversify.
Today, the fourth generation of the Mukherjee family manages the John Smeal legacy, steering the company into the global market. With a return to our roots, we have ventured into the export business, reconnecting with our historical ties to the East India Company. This latest chapter in our journey is a testament to our enduring commitment to growth, innovation, and the preservation of a legacy that has spanned over a century and a half.
